ice storm in south missouri

this ice storm in south missouri can not be summed up into words, but if it was the only one that I can think of is tragic. This a pics. of a dog at JD Plunkett's one of the happy customers we got power to while in hytie mo. This was one of the few animals we saw down there. notice the downed powerlines in bottom of the pic.
this is a picture of guess who, yours truly tying in the new powerline
This was a great moment the pole that i am on below has a transformer on it that feeds one light down the street in the town of hayward while tying it in i hooked the light up on the way down. two days later when we turned the power back on to some people, low and behold i see the light come on. talk about a good feeling. the next day on the way to work on another piece of line the words Thank You were wrote on a cardboard box set at the side of the road. Those words made everything worth it.
